Spearfish Canyon has one of South Dakota’s most remarkable landscapes in the world. Its towering limestone walls, dense forests, flowing creek, and seasonal waterfalls create an ever-changing experience throughout the year, especially during the fall.
Spring runoff brings new energy to the waterfalls. Summer covers the canyon in brilliant green, full of native flowers. Autumn transforms the landscape with gold, orange, and red, while winter strips the Hills down to their quietest form.
